Clwyd South
2019 General Election · 12 December 2019 · Wales
Simon Baynes (Conservative) won the seat, a Con gain from Lab, with a majority of 1,239 on a 67.3% turnout.
Electorate 53,919 · Valid votes 36,306 · Turnout 67.3%
| Candidate | Party | Votes | Share |
|---|---|---|---|
| Simon Baynes | Conservative | 16,222 | 44.7% |
| Susan Jones (sitting MP) | Labour | 14,983 | 41.3% |
| Chris Allen | Plaid Cymru | 2,137 | 5.9% |
| Calum Davies | Liberal Democrat | 1,496 | 4.1% |
| Jamie Adams | The Brexit Party | 1,468 | 4% |
